Output 21c95358ca7eb1aa498c00356455baac7fcdf5cfd9eded8ade8a951f96f2ce7f:1

value
66538
script pubkey
OP_0 OP_PUSHBYTES_20 26fa34c081e18d6ed0c20cfbe98beb06f4596a27
address
bc1qymarfsypuxxka5xzpna7nzltqm69j638uxspsa
transaction
21c95358ca7eb1aa498c00356455baac7fcdf5cfd9eded8ade8a951f96f2ce7f
confirmations
65257
spent
true